What Does A Mason Contractor Do. what does a mason do? masonry refers to the construction of structures using individual units, typically made of natural materials like brick, concrete blocks, or stone. They play a specific role in providing builders with things such as masonry construction, masonry repair, and other diverse applications of masonry. Masons work with a range of materials like stone, brick and concrete to install chimneys, retaining walls, patios and entire homes. what does a masonry contractor do? Masonry contractors are individuals who have been trained in the field of masonry construction. a mason in the construction industry is responsible for building structures using individual units of brick, stone, or concrete. masons are responsible for constructing, repairing, and maintaining structures such as walls, floors, pavements, chimneys, and other architectural elements.
